House Rules


  1. No Smoking in the house.
  2. Air Con in room is allowed to be turn on when students are in it. Air con/Lights must be turn off when students leaves the room. Air con privileges may be forfeited if this is not complied as wastage of energy is strictly not condone. 
  3. No stove top cooking is permitted.
  4. Laundry must be neatly placed in the laundry basket provided. (Laundry not placed in the basket will not be washed.)
  5. Curfew is 2230 hours
  6. Shoes must be neatly placed on the shoe racked provided.
  7. Masterbed room are strictly off limits.
  8. Permission must be obtained to use the swimming pool and students must dry themselves thoroughly before entering house after use of pool.
  9. No bringing of friends home unless permission is granted by guardians.
  10. Rooms are off bounds to students of the opposite genders. 
  11. Students are to inform guardians a day before regarding having meals at home or else they will have to provide for their own meals. 
General Courtesy
  1. Inform guardians if there's a change in your tuition dates and times.
  2. Utensils are to be placed in the wash basin after your meals.
  3. Rubbish are to be thrown into rubbish bins provided.
  4. Keep phones, laptops, audio equipment volume to a considerate level.
  5. Switch off lights and close windows in common areas before bed.
  6. No shouting/screaming or swearing in the house.
